65 RV Parks & Campgrounds in Yuma, AZ
Yuma, Arizona sits at 157 feet of elevation in the low desert, where sunshine dominates the calendar nearly year-round. RV parks here cater heavily to active adults and snowbirds seeking warm winters and golf-centered communities. The city anchors access to the Colorado River, Castle Dome Mines Museum, and Yuma Territorial Prison State Historic Park. Multiple privately owned resorts and government-managed options operate across the region, each with distinct character and amenities.
Westwind RV & Golf Resort in Yuma positions itself as a five-star snowbird destination in the foothills, with an 18-hole golf course as the centerpiece and extensive recreational facilities throughout the property. Country Roads RV Village spans 140 acres as an active senior community with five heated swimming pools and a homeowner-governed structure built around leisure activities and volunteer opportunities. Sun Vista RV Resort, operating since 1984, features 1,230 level RV sites with 30 and 50 amp service, concrete patios, and full hookups, plus extensive recreational facilities including a spa. Fortuna De Oro RV Park operates as a 55+ active senior community with an on-site golf course and sits within Cal-Am Properties' network of premium resorts. Blue Sky RV Resort rounds out the well-known options. Amenities across these parks typically include free Wi-Fi, fitness centers, golf courses, smoke-free policies, outdoor pools, and kid-friendly spaces.
Travelers base themselves here to explore the Yuma Crossing National Heritage Area, venture across the border to Mexico, or spend time along the Colorado River. Gateway Park and Mittry Lake Wildlife Area draw outdoor enthusiasts. Joshua Tree National Park lies 111 miles away for those wanting to extend their trip into California. The Yuma Proving Ground Heritage Center and Yuma Territorial Prison Park offer regional history lessons within short drives.
Yuma's desert terrain and elevation of 157 feet create mild winters and hot summers. January temperatures average 57 degrees Fahrenheit, while July climbs to 92 degrees. Annual precipitation totals just 6.8 inches, making this one of the driest regions in the Southwest. Winter months from November through March draw the heaviest RV traffic, as snowbirds escape colder climates. Summer visitors find fewer crowds and more availability, though heat becomes the primary consideration for outdoor activities.
